Mosaic Pale Ale
C.H. Evans Brewing Company at the Albany Pump Station in Albany, New York, United States 🇺🇸
Pale Ale - American Style / APA Regular Out of Production|

100% Mosaic hops yield a juicy and deliciously drinkable hoppy brew. Big notes of citrus, berry, and some tropical pine. Smooth and easy drinking

Reviewed from notes.
On tap at C.H. Evans.
Appearance: muted copper/brassy color with a bar pour's kind of slim white foamy head which dissipated at a nice pace and barely left any lace
Aroma: citrusy sweet and bitter toned hops with some piney sweetness; light malty tones underneath
Flavor: meshes the prior noted aromas to a fine sweet to bitter to bittersweet quality; finishes leaning into the sweetness of the citrusy hops
Texture: light to medium bodied, sessionable; some smoothness along the tongue; seems like good carb
Overall: nice enough easy drinker of a pale ale that the second one went well with my cheesesteak sandwich.
